TY - JOUR
T1 - WiKAN: Lightweight Kolmogorov–Arnold Networks for accurate indoor WiFi localization
AU - Gu, Yunlong
AU - Xu, Meng
AU - Li, Jiguang
AU - Li, Qilei
AU - Huang, Zhao
AU - Li, Mengshan
AU - Guan, Lixin
AU - Valkama, Mikko
PY - 2025/11/1
Y1 - 2025/11/1
N2 - With the growing demand for location-based services, WiFi localization plays a critical role in indoor environments. While most existing methods rely on Multi-Layer Perceptrons (MLPs), these models often suffer from limited accuracy and poor generalization across diverse deployment conditions. Kolmogorov–Arnold Networks (KANs), with their B-spline-based basis functions, better capture complex nonlinear relationships while reducing overfitting risks. However, original KANs still incur high computational costs. To address this, we propose WiKAN(WiFi KAN), a lightweight KAN-based model for indoor WiFi localization. WiKAN reduces computational complexity by simplifying the network structure to just two KANLinear layers and replacing parameter-intensive operations with optimized matrix multiplications using reconstructed basis functions. Compared to conventional computation of basis coefficients, matrix operations enable faster inference on modern hardware and improve scalability. Furthermore, WiKAN integrates SiLU and B-spline activations through a learnable linear combination, balancing smooth approximation and nonlinear representation. Experiments on three benchmark datasets (UJIIndoorLoc, Tampere, and JARIL) demonstrate that WiKAN achieves superior performance to both MLP and standard KAN models: over 99.9% building accuracy, up to 100% floor classification, and average positioning error reduced to 5.91 meters. Additionally, runtime analysis and parameter count comparisons confirm the model’s computational efficiency. Code is publicly available at: https://github.com/gyl555666/WiKAN.
AB - With the growing demand for location-based services, WiFi localization plays a critical role in indoor environments. While most existing methods rely on Multi-Layer Perceptrons (MLPs), these models often suffer from limited accuracy and poor generalization across diverse deployment conditions. Kolmogorov–Arnold Networks (KANs), with their B-spline-based basis functions, better capture complex nonlinear relationships while reducing overfitting risks. However, original KANs still incur high computational costs. To address this, we propose WiKAN(WiFi KAN), a lightweight KAN-based model for indoor WiFi localization. WiKAN reduces computational complexity by simplifying the network structure to just two KANLinear layers and replacing parameter-intensive operations with optimized matrix multiplications using reconstructed basis functions. Compared to conventional computation of basis coefficients, matrix operations enable faster inference on modern hardware and improve scalability. Furthermore, WiKAN integrates SiLU and B-spline activations through a learnable linear combination, balancing smooth approximation and nonlinear representation. Experiments on three benchmark datasets (UJIIndoorLoc, Tampere, and JARIL) demonstrate that WiKAN achieves superior performance to both MLP and standard KAN models: over 99.9% building accuracy, up to 100% floor classification, and average positioning error reduced to 5.91 meters. Additionally, runtime analysis and parameter count comparisons confirm the model’s computational efficiency. Code is publicly available at: https://github.com/gyl555666/WiKAN.
KW - WiFi
KW - Kolmogorov–Arnold Networks (KANs)
KW - Multi-layer perceptron (MLP)
KW - Indoor localization
UR - https://www.scopus.com/pages/publications/105018173825
U2 - 10.1016/j.pmcj.2025.102121
DO - 10.1016/j.pmcj.2025.102121
M3 - Article
SN - 1574-1192
VL - 114
JO - Pervasive and Mobile Computing
JF - Pervasive and Mobile Computing
M1 - 102121
ER -